Convict name: Biggs, Joseph.

sentence_details:
Convicted at Cambridge Assizes for a term of 15 years on 19 March 1863.

vessel: Merchantman

date_of_departure: 29 June 1864.

place_of_arrival: Western Australia.

source:
Microfilm Roll 93, Class and Piece Number HO11/19, Page Number 33 (19)

title:
Joseph Biggs, one of 260 convicts transported on the Merchantman, 29 June 1864.

publication_details:
Canberra [A.C.T.] :Australian Joint Copying Project,[1948-1990]

original_version_note:
This record is one of the entries in the British convict transportation registers 1787-1867 database compiled by State Library of Queensland from British Home Office (HO) records which are available on microfilm as part of the Australian Joint Copying Project (AJCP).
